如何使用Python开发HTTP POST请求
前言
作为一名经验丰富的开发者,掌握HTTP POST请求是非常基础且重要的一项技能。在本文中,我将教会你如何使用Python实现HTTP POST请求,让你能够轻松地与服务器进行数据交互。
流程
首先,让我们来看一下实现HTTP POST请求的整个流程。我们可以将流程分解成以下几个步骤:
| 步骤 | 描述 |
|---|---|
| 1 | 构建POST请求的URL |
| 2 | 创建POST请求的数据 |
| 3 | 发送POST请求 |
| 4 | 处理服务器返回的响应数据 |
具体步骤
步骤1:构建POST请求的URL
在这一步,我们需要确定我们要发送POST请求的URL地址。
url = "
步骤2:创建POST请求的数据
接下来,我们需要创建需要发送的数据。通常我们会使用字典的形式来表示POST数据。
data = {
"key1": "value1",
"key2": "value2"
}
步骤3:发送POST请求
现在,我们可以使用Python的requests库来发送POST请求。
import requests
response = requests.post(url, data=data)
步骤4:处理服务器返回的响应数据
最后,我们可以处理服务器返回的响应数据。
print(response.text)
总结
通过以上步骤,你已经学会了如何使用Python开发HTTP POST请求。希望这篇文章能够帮助到你,让你更加熟练地进行数据交互。如果有任何问题,欢迎随时向我提问。
pie
title Python开发HTTP POST请求流程
"构建URL" : 25
"创建数据" : 25
"发送请求" : 25
"处理响应" : 25
stateDiagram
[*] --> 构建URL
构建URL --> 创建数据
创建数据 --> 发送请求
发送请求 --> 处理响应
处理响应 --> [*]
希望本文能够对你有所帮助,祝你编程顺利!
















